产品名称: Purpureocillium lilacinum (Thom) Luangsa-ard et al.
商品货号: TS164544
Deposited As: Paecilomyces lilacinus (Thom) Samson
Strain Designations: 20
Application:
produces ovicide
Biosafety Level: 1

Biosafety classification is based on U.S. Public Health Service Guidelines, it is the responsibility of the customer to ensure that their facilities comply with biosafety regulations for their own country.

Product Format: freeze-dried
Storage Conditions: Frozen: -80°C or colder
Freeze-Dried: 2°C to 8°C
Live Culture: See Propagation Section
Type Strain: no
Preceptrol®: no
Comments:
Nematocide
Medium: ATCC® Medium 336: Potato dextrose agar (PDA)
ATCC® Medium 323: Malt agar medium
ATCC® Medium 312: Czapeks agar
Growth Conditions:
Temperature: 24°C to 26°C
Atmosphere: Typical aerobic
Sequenced Data:
18S ribosomal RNA gene, partial sequence; internal transcribed spacer 1, 5.8S ribosomal RNA gene, and internal transcribed spacer 2, complete sequence; and 28S ribosomal RNA gene, partial sequence

D1D2 region of the 28S ribosomal RNA gene

Name of Depositor: H Lysek
Isolation:
Soil, Czechoslovakia
References:

Kunert J, et al. Polysaccharide-hydrolyzing activity of ovicidal fungi. Biologia 37: 291-299, 1982.
